Second Harvest makes food resources available to feeding sites in response to cold weather

News Date: 
January 07, 2010

JACKSONVILLE, Fla. – With temperatures in north Florida dipping to record lows, and the current freezing trend not showing signs of lessening in the days ahead, Second Harvest North Florida is doing its part to ensure that Jacksonville’s hunger-fighting organizations have additional resources to handle the increased volume of people seeking assistance.
